I try to destring two variables. One of them is the column for my cross-sectional units and the other is for my observations. They are different counties over a period of time, e.g. “CountyX2006”, “CountyY2007” etc.
I can’t understand why there are nonnumeric characters in these variables.
I tried running:
destring observation, replace
But Stata returns “observation contains nonnumeric characters; no replace”
Any ideas how to solve this problem? I've never encountered it before.
The reason I want to destring is is in order to use the command "xtset" that requires a numeric identifier.
EDIT
I think I solved this now. I encoded the counties, using:
"encode county, gen(county1)"
and used county1 in xtset instead
